Rising Consumer Awareness and Health-Conscious Lifestyles:

The Natural Food and Drinks Market is benefiting from a global shift toward healthier eating habits and lifestyle choices. Consumers are increasingly scrutinizing ingredient labels and seeking clean-label products that exclude artificial additives, preservatives, and genetically modified organisms (GMOs). This growing demand for transparency has prompted manufacturers to adopt natural formulations and emphasize health benefits on product packaging. Rising incidences of lifestyle-related diseases such as obesity, diabetes, and cardiovascular disorders have further strengthened the demand for nutrient-dense, natural alternatives. The market continues to expand as consumers view natural products as safer and more beneficial to long-term health. This heightened awareness is particularly evident among millennials and Gen Z, who prioritize wellness and sustainability in their dietary preferences.

Regulatory Support and Organic Certification Initiatives:

Government policies supporting organic farming and clean-label standards are driving the growth of the Natural Food and Drinks Market. Regulatory agencies across regions such as North America and Europe have established clear guidelines for organic certification, which boosts consumer confidence and market legitimacy. These frameworks encourage manufacturers to reformulate offerings and introduce new products that align with compliance standards. Financial incentives and subsidies for organic agriculture have also contributed to the increased availability of raw materials. In emerging markets, growing government focus on food safety and agricultural sustainability is accelerating the transition from conventional to organic production. These initiatives are helping build trust and opening up new growth avenues for the industry.

  • For instance, the European Union’s Common Agricultural Policy provides financial incentives for farmers adopting organic and sustainable practices, while India’s Paramparagat Krishi Vikas Yojana (PKVY) offers direct support and certification for organic farming clusters.

Expansion of Modern Retail Channels and E-Commerce Penetration:

Retail modernization and the rapid expansion of e-commerce are enhancing product visibility and consumer access across the Natural Food and Drinks Market. Organized retail formats and specialty stores are offering dedicated sections for natural and organic products, making them more accessible to mainstream buyers. Online platforms have created opportunities for smaller and regional brands to reach wider audiences without heavy investments in traditional distribution. The convenience of online shopping, combined with detailed product information and user reviews, influences purchasing decisions. Subscription-based models and direct-to-consumer sales channels are gaining popularity in the natural food segment. These developments are reshaping how consumers discover and engage with natural food and beverage products.

  • For instance, in India, modern retail outlets such as Nature’s Basket, Foodhall, and FabIndia, as well as e-commerce platforms like Bigbasket and Amazon Fresh, have dedicated organic sections that make these products widely accessible.

Growing Demand for Functional and Fortified Natural Products:

The Natural Food and Drinks Market is witnessing a notable shift toward products that offer functional health benefits beyond basic nutrition. Consumers are increasingly choosing items enriched with vitamins, minerals, probiotics, and adaptogens to support immunity, digestion, and cognitive health. Brands are responding by introducing natural beverages infused with herbal extracts, superfoods, and plant-based proteins. The demand for immunity-boosting and stress-reducing ingredients has grown, especially after the global pandemic, which heightened awareness of preventive health. Natural products with added functionality are gaining shelf space across retail formats, from health stores to mainstream supermarkets. This trend is expanding the market scope and encouraging continuous product innovation.

  • For instance, Reed’s Kombucha and Health-Ade’s Probiotic Kombucha are leading examples of probiotic-rich beverages supporting gut health.

High Production Costs and Pricing Pressures Limit Mass Adoption:

The Natural Food and Drinks Market faces challenges due to high production and sourcing costs associated with organic and minimally processed ingredients. These products often require premium inputs, strict quality controls, and certification processes that increase operational expenses. Manufacturers struggle to maintain competitive pricing, especially in price-sensitive markets where conventional alternatives remain dominant. Limited availability of certified organic raw materials also affects supply chain stability and consistency. Smaller companies find it difficult to scale due to these financial barriers, restricting broader product access. The cost gap between natural and conventional offerings continues to deter a significant portion of mainstream consumers.

  • For instance, ADM has successfully implemented sustainable sourcing strategies to optimize production costs while maintaining high-quality standards.

Limited Shelf Life and Distribution Constraints Affect Market Reach:

Shorter shelf life presents a major logistical challenge in the Natural Food and Drinks Market. Products free from preservatives and artificial stabilizers often require cold storage and fast turnover, which complicates distribution and retail management. This leads to higher spoilage risks and increased handling costs for both manufacturers and retailers. It also limits market penetration in remote and rural areas lacking robust cold chain infrastructure. Ensuring freshness while maintaining scalability remains a key operational hurdle. Regional Analysis:

North America Leads the Market with Strong Retail and Health-Conscious Consumer Base

North America accounts for 38% of the global Natural Food and Drinks Market, with the United States contributing the largest portion due to high consumer spending and retail penetration. The region benefits from widespread awareness of clean-label trends, supported by a well-established infrastructure of health-focused supermarkets and online platforms. Regulatory clarity and strong labelling laws continue to promote consumer trust and drive brand loyalty. Consumers are actively seeking organic, non-GMO, and functional products, particularly in beverages and plant-based categories. The growth of vegan and flexitarian diets further fuels innovation and shelf space expansion. North American companies invest heavily in R&D, marketing, and sustainable sourcing to retain competitive advantage.

Europe Drives Demand through Sustainability and Regulatory Support

Europe captures 30% of the Natural Food and Drinks Market, backed by robust regulatory frameworks and consumer preference for ethical and sustainable products. Germany, France, and the United Kingdom lead regional demand, driven by mature organic food sectors and eco-conscious buying habits. Certification schemes such as EU Organic and Fair-Trade influence purchasing decisions and shape product development. Retail chains and health food stores offer wide selections of natural items across categories. Ingredient transparency and clean-label appeal play a key role in building customer trust. Local producers and multinational brands alike focus on minimizing artificial inputs and maximizing nutritional value.

Asia Pacific Emerges as Fastest-Growing Region in the Market

Asia Pacific holds 22% of the global Natural Food and Drinks Market and is projected to register the fastest growth rate. China, India, Japan, and South Korea lead regional demand due to rising health awareness, urbanization, and changing dietary habits. The prevalence of diet-related health issues is prompting consumers to adopt nutrient-dense and minimally processed food options. Retail expansion and e-commerce platforms are improving product access, especially in urban and tier-2 cities. Regional companies are customizing offerings to align with traditional tastes and cultural preferences. Government policies encouraging organic farming and food safety are supporting market expansion across developing economies.
